Lemawork Ketema: Keep on Running dives deep into the life of a runner who sacrifices so much for his passion. There's this rawness in how Lemawork's story unfolds, you really feel the weight of his journey from Ethiopia to Austria. The documentary captures the relentless spirit of an athlete chasing dreams, highlighting both the physical and emotional hurdles he faces. The pacing is reflective, allowing moments of introspection that resonate well with viewers. It's not just about running; it’s about resilience and hope against the odds. The filming style is straightforward but effective, letting Lemawork’s dedication and struggles shine through without overly dramatizing. This film might not be flashy, but it’s honest, and that’s what makes it compelling.
